SUBARU (TELESCOPE)


'Subaru Telescope' (In Japanese: すばる望遠鏡) is the 8.2 metre flagship telescope of the National Astronomical Observatory of Japan, located in Mauna Kea Observatory on Hawaii. It is named after the open star cluster known in English as the Pleiades.
Construction of the telescope began in April 1991, and the first scientific images were taken in January 1999.[1]
It is a Cassegrain reflector.
